Developing a Style Modelling System for Creative Generative Music Improvisation

نویسنده

  • Nigel Stephen D’Souza
چکیده

This dissertation describes an exploratory style modelling application intended to simulate a guitar player's style and replicate it with some degree of creativity and originality. This was achieved using a combination of a stochastic technique (Markov Chains) and a biochemical restructuring process (Autocatalytic Set Theory). The key objective was to see if natural restructuring processes could enhance traditional stochastic style modelling techniques in order to promote creative improvisation in computer generated music. In short, the program generates improvised solos in the guitar player's style and adds an element of originality. Previous studies into style modelling and generative music are discussed in the literature review. Based on the arguments put forward, ideas for a program simulation are suggested. Next, there is a description of the program developed in Java to implement these ideas. Various tests are conducted and the results analyzed. Finally, a discussion follows to provide a theoretical insight into the evaluation of the success of the model. 2 The tests conducted yielded mostly positive results, suggesting that the model has a sound theoretical foundation and has the potential for further development and expansion. Finally, conclusions are drawn about the reasons for the success of the model and the techniques used. It is recommended that future studies should be carried out to expand on the ideas presented here and develop the model further. Please note that a basic knowledge of music theory and terminology is required in order to fully understand some of the content of this dissertation. However, this is not essential. This dissertation comes with a CD containing the program, its technical documentation, a user manual, test data and output samples.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

A System for Computer Music Generation by Learning and Improvisation in a Particular Style

The paper deals with question of music modeling and generation, capturing the idiomatic style of a composer or a genre, in an attempt to provide the computer with “creative”, human-like capabilities. The system described in the paper performs analyses of musical sequences and computes a model according to which new interpretations / improvisations close to the original's style can be generated....

متن کامل

Software Agents and Creating Music/sound Art: Frames, Directions, and where to from here?

Practitioners have begun to use software agents to compose music and sound art in linear and non-linear idioms: ‘non-linear’ being defined here as demonstrated when a composer does not set the form/structure and/or content of a work, so there are varying realisations of it. Agent technology is first introduced, then a conceptual framework for its use in composition given. Recent creative work u...

متن کامل

Human-Computer Co-Creativity: Blending Human and Computational Creativity

This paper describes a thesis exploring how computer programs can collaborate as equals in the artistic creative process. The proposed system, CoCo Sketch, encodes some rudimentary stylistic rules of abstract sketching and music theory to contribute supplemental lines and music while the user sketches. We describe a three-part research method that includes defining rudimentary stylistic rules f...

متن کامل

A creative artificially-intuitive and reasoning agent in the context of live music improvisation

This paper reports on the architecture and performance of a creative artificially-intuitive and reasoning agent (CAIRA) as an improviser and conductor for improvised avant-garde music. The agent’s listening skills are based on a music recognition system that simulates the human auditory periphery to perform an Auditory Scene Analysis (ASA). Its simulation of cognitive processes includes a cogni...

متن کامل

Generative Improv. & Interactive Music Project (GIIMP)

GIIMP addresses the criticism that in many interactive music systems the machine simply reacts. Interaction is addressed by extending Winkler’s [18] model toward adapting Paine’s [10] conversational model of interaction. Realized using commercial tools, GIIMP implements a machine/human generative improvisation system using human gesture input, machine gesture capture, and a gesture mutation mod...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2007